#3fc004 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#3fc004 is composed of 24.7% red, 75.3% green and 1.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 67.2% cyan, 0% magenta, 97.9% yellow and 24.7% black. It has a hue angle of 101.2 degrees, a saturation of 95.9% and a lightness of 38.4%. #3fc004 color hex could be obtained by blending #7eff08 with #008100. Closest websafe color is: #33cc00.

Shades and Tints of #3fc004
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#061300 is the darkest color, while #ffffff is the lightest one.

Tones of #3fc004
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#61665e is the less saturated color, while #3fc004 is the most saturated one.
